House Greenfield of Greenfield is a knightly house of the Westerlands, sworn to House Lannister of Casterly Rock. It descends from the First Men, and its name goes back to a castle raised entirely from weirwood trees, long before the Conquest.

The weirwood castle

Books only

The Greenfields' origins lie in the golden age of the First Men, when strongholds in Westeros were still built from the pale wood of weirwood trees.

From that time comes the Enreradera, the castle that gave the house its name and which, as the story goes, was built entirely out of those trees.
